Eddy Resolving Global Ocean Prediction Including Tides
Abstract
LONG-TERM GOALS: Use the HYbrid Coordinate Ocean Model (HYCOM) with tides, dynamic sea ice, and data assimilation in an eddy-resolving, fully global ocean prediction system with 1/25 deg horizontal resolution that will run in real time at the Naval Oceanographic Office (NAVOCEANO) starting in 2012. The model will include shallow water and provide boundary conditions to finer resolution coastal models that may use HYCOM or a different model. OBJECTIVES: To develop, evaluate, and investigate the dynamics of 1/25 deg global HYCOM (HYbrid Coordinate Ocean Model) with tides coupled to CICE (the Los Alamos sea ice model) with atmospheric forcing only, with data assimilation via NCODA (NRL Coupled Ocean Data Assimilation), and in forecast mode. Also to incorporate advances in dynamics and physics from the science community into the HYCOM established and maintained within the Navy.
